A mele hānau (birth chant) for Kauikeaouli (Kamehameha III), who was born in 1814, describes the chiefly lineage in the context of creation and genealogy spanning—the heavens; placing the sun above; the spirit realms and physical earth—land and ocean forms; the birth of the island of Hawaiʻi; and subsequent birth of Mauna Kea, as the son of Wākea. Our first thought should be the mountain and to Wakea. “When we talk about sacred, we’re talking about something that is special and set apart because of religious or spiritual reasons,” says Tengan, “So in relation to Mauna Kea or Mauna a Wākea, it is seen as kapu because of its place in at least one genealogical chant that recites the birthing of the mauna as the kapu first born child of Wākea.” Poliahu, the snow goddess of Mauna-kea, was reared and lived like the daughter of an ancient chief of Hawaii. ... Mauna Kea is the child’s piko, which is translated to umbilical cord, navel, or belly button (Puhipau 2006). Hānau ka mauna he keiki kapu na Kea The mountain is born, a sacred child of Kea ‘Ae ka mauna, hānau ka mauna The mountain, the mountain is born The chant provides a dichotomy of understanding for the erudite as well as the practical.
